Generalized Cytomegalic Inclusion Disease: Report of An Autopsy Case and Review of Literature
Journal of the Korean Pediatric Society ; : 1003-1008, 1979.
Article in Korean | WPRIM | ID: wpr-41007
ABSTRACT
The authors experienced a case of generalized bytomegalic inclusion diseas, characterized by numerous petechiae associated with anemia and hepatomegly, in the premature infant who was hypotonic and cyanosed, with respiratory difficulty and an Apgar score of 4 at 1 minute. The rapid deterioration of the case condition was followed by the death occurring nine hours after birth. The diagnosis was confirmed by the autopsy, and a brief review of the literature was made.
